Subject: Quickstore 4.2 — bloom filter now fronts the KV layer

Plugin authors: starting with this release, Quickstore places a bloom filter ahead of the key-value store. Negative lookups return faster; false positives fall through safely. No API changes are required on your side. Verify your plugin against the staging build referenced below.

session token of fahif-tadup = htk3_9c7

Handover: Broker Upgrade (Quillbus 3 → 4)

For whoever picks this up: the Quillbus 4 upgrade is done on staging, pending on production. Queue mirroring semantics changed, so the consumer ack settings were retuned; don't revert them. The old management plugin is incompatible and has been removed. Rollback requires draining all queues first. Staging currently runs with the configuration below, which production should match after cut-over.

deployment values, kajep-kageg:
[praix]
host = praix.paliqcorp.corp
user = praix_svc
database = praix_prod

**Troubleshooting: Audit-log viewer shows empty pages for plugin events**

Plugin authors: if your events vanish in the Ledgerlight viewer, it's almost always a missing `source` field — the viewer silently filters unlabeled entries. Tag every event with your plugin slug and they'll show up within a minute. Still blank? Hit the debug feed directly and check raw ingestion, authenticating with the token below.

login token, bagug-kafop: eyJhbGciOiJIUzI1NiIsInR5cCI6IkpXVCJ9.eyJzdWIiOiIcMLov2In0.Z5RLDIfp